Welcome to on-call for the Glimmerpane design system! Our snapshot tests live in the `snapcheck` suite and run on every merge to main. If a UI component changes visually, the diff bot flags it — usually it's an intentional tweak, so just approve the new baseline. If it's 2am and snapshots are failing across the board, it's almost always a font-loading race, not your problem. To unlock the baseline store and re-approve snapshots in bulk, use the recovery passphrase below.

recovery phrase for tahag-taguf: wenix-caswyn

**Q: Where do I register a new event schema?**

All event schemas at Quillbrook go through Schemary, our central schema registry. Submit your schema as a pull request against the registry repo; compatibility checks run automatically and breaking changes are rejected unless a version bump is declared. Approved schemas publish within minutes. The registration walkthrough, naming conventions, and review checklist are documented on the internal page.

runbook for tafof-yawif: https://confluence.tolvaqsys.internal/display/display/browse/pages/7be3

Runbook: Search relevance tuning — Hollowfen

Heads up for reviewers: the relevance knobs for Hollowfen search live in config, not code, so a PR touching scoring should also touch these values. We tune boosts quarterly and freeze them between tuning windows. If recall drops after a deploy, compare against the frozen baseline first. The current baseline values are below.

service settings:
PRAIX_LOG_LEVEL=error
PRAIX_METRICS_HOST=metrics.praix.qorvelcorp.corp
PRAIX_POOL_SIZE=16